The guests of the Kempinski-Zografski Hotel in Sofia had to be evacuated twice over phone bomb threats in the last couple of days. Photo by BGNES

The Bulgarian police have arrested a person who is charged with the hoax bomb threats against the five-star hotel Kempinski-Zografski.

The Kempinski-Zografski received two bomb threats over the phone within 24 hours – one Tuesday and another one Wednesday night, and its guests had to be evacuated as the police searched the building finding no trace of explosives.

The news about the arrest have been announced by the Secretary-General of the Interior Ministry, Kalin Georgiev, who also said a second man was wanted for the same crime.

Georgiev stressed that the two suspects were not fully aware of what they had committed but he did not specify whether they were mentally unstable. One of the two men has actually been sentenced for making hoax phone threats.
